This 68 427 Corvette just found and changed hands in Georgia after being with second owner for 46 years.
This is the shop that built the first couple of GT’s until they burned a car and Joel switched to Gary for the GT builds. Last edited by x Baldwin Motion; 08-20-2020 at 05:33 PM. |
